Qatar to introduce Silatech, a new employment scheme for youth
Qatar, on Tuesday, announced a new employment scheme, namely, 100-million-dollar investment scheme in a new initiative, intended to combat youth unemployment, in the Middle East and North Africa.
The announcement was made by the Alliance of Civilizations Forum, which is a new initiative, intended to promote cross-cultural understanding, by Sheikha Mozah bint Nasser Al Missned, wife of Emir of Qatar.
She pointed out that high unemployment rate prevails among the people in Middle East and North Africa, adding that, such people would be a terrible mistake in future.
Qatar is putting 100 million dollars into an initiative called Silatech, to combat the problem, by connecting youngsters to business and employment.
“By investing in the youth, we are investing in the security and development of our nations and only secure nations can build alliances on mutual respect and common objectives,” she mentioned.
